Gustavo Romero 77fad8bfb1 selftests/powerpc: Check FP/VEC on exception in TM
Add a self test to check if FP/VEC/VSX registers are sane (restored
correctly) after a FP/VEC/VSX unavailable exception is caught during a
transaction.

This test checks all possibilities in a thread regarding the combination
of MSR.[FP|VEC] states in a thread and for each scenario raises a
FP/VEC/VSX unavailable exception in transactional state, verifying if
vs0 and vs32 registers, which are representatives of FP/VEC/VSX reg
sets, are not corrupted.

/*
* Copyright 2015, Michael Ellerman, IBM Corp.
* Licensed under GPLv2.
*/
#ifndef _SELFTESTS_POWERPC_TM_TM_H
#define _SELFTESTS_POWERPC_TM_TM_H
#include <asm/tm.h>
#include <asm/cputable.h>
#include <stdbool.h>
#include "utils.h"
static inline bool have_htm(void)
{
#ifdef PPC_FEATURE2_HTM
return have_hwcap2(PPC_FEATURE2_HTM);
#else
printf("PPC_FEATURE2_HTM not defined, can't check AT_HWCAP2\n");
return false;
#endif
}
static inline bool have_htm_nosc(void)
{
#ifdef PPC_FEATURE2_HTM_NOSC
return have_hwcap2(PPC_FEATURE2_HTM_NOSC);
#else
printf("PPC_FEATURE2_HTM_NOSC not defined, can't check AT_HWCAP2\n");
return false;
#endif
}
static inline long failure_code(void)
{
return __builtin_get_texasru() >> 24;
}
static inline bool failure_is_persistent(void)
{
return (failure_code() & TM_CAUSE_PERSISTENT) == TM_CAUSE_PERSISTENT;
}
static inline bool failure_is_syscall(void)
{
return (failure_code() & TM_CAUSE_SYSCALL) == TM_CAUSE_SYSCALL;
}
static inline bool failure_is_unavailable(void)
{
return (failure_code() & TM_CAUSE_FAC_UNAV) == TM_CAUSE_FAC_UNAV;
}
static inline bool failure_is_nesting(void)
{
return (__builtin_get_texasru() & 0x400000);
}
static inline int tcheck(void)
{
long cr;
asm volatile ("tcheck 0" : "=r"(cr) : : "cr0");
return (cr >> 28) & 4;
}
static inline bool tcheck_doomed(void)
{
return tcheck() & 8;
}
static inline bool tcheck_active(void)
{
return tcheck() & 4;
}
static inline bool tcheck_suspended(void)
{
return tcheck() & 2;
}
static inline bool tcheck_transactional(void)
{
return tcheck() & 6;
}
#endif /* _SELFTESTS_POWERPC_TM_TM_H */
